Output 421fc7bed08d1258d7eaa7510501ac32aba08b593ff2b652370496381ec1e578:1

value
1540000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67183068bc5a6e58e20ffe79fadfdf05f37619b7 OP_EQUALVERIFY OP_CHECKSIG
address
1AQ7aSu9dLoXHnV8TGeTZi1mPRboPwgziM
transaction
421fc7bed08d1258d7eaa7510501ac32aba08b593ff2b652370496381ec1e578
confirmations
510683
spent
true